Reduce your bills The combination of IPACK 3.3 and solar panel system is the perfect solution for powering your home. When the solar system generates too much electricity, store electricity in the IPACK 3.3 instead of wasting it. When the solar system can't meet your electricity needs, let the battery power join. If facing a time-of-use tariff charging policy, you can store cheap grid electricity in your IPACK 3.3 and then use it when expensive, which is equivalent to using electricity at the cheapest price all the time. Substantial return on investment By pairing solar energy with IPACK C6.5, the excess power produced during the day can be stored in the battery and used when the sun goes down, which is more attractive than selling electricity to the grid. If facing time-of-use rates or home charging rates, IPACK can charge when electricity is cheap and used when grid electricity is more expensive, which means you're always using the cheapest electricity. Icube uses a new RTS (Rack To Station) design concept and highly productizes the entire engineering project. It not only improves system reliability and operational efficiency but also reduces overall cost. Icube not only has a short construction cycle, but its arrayed portfolio solution is highly scalable, so it can be quickly delivered and deployed in a variety of projects. Turnkey Solution We provide our customers not one by one module, but a whole set of energy storage systems, which integrates battery pack, control system, water cooling system, fire fighting system, PCS system, monitoring system in total. As a highly integrated, productized system,all modules can work together more efficiently and seamlessly, which reduces the cost and improves the performance and stability of the system at the same time. The whole system is plug-and-play, and customers do not need to spend too much time and effort on installation, commissioning, operation and maintenance.
